Quick Checks for i-Pro No Video
Before diving into advanced diagnostics, perform these 30-second checks:
- Verify VMS Dashboard Status: In your VMS (e.g. Wisenet WAVE or Avigilon Control Center), check if the camera shows online but no video. A red status icon may indicate a stream profile mismatch.
- Check PoE Link Light: On the switch port, ensure the PoE link light is solid green. A blinking or amber light may indicate insufficient power or negotiation failure.
- Ping the Camera IP: Use the ping command from the VMS server to confirm the camera is reachable. A time-out suggests network partitioning or firewall rules blocking traffic.
- Inspect Status LED: On the camera body, the status LED should blink blue when connected. A solid red indicates firmware update failure or hardware error.
- Power Cycle via Switch: Disable and re-enable the switch port to trigger a PoE restart. This resolves temporary negotiation issues on models like the WV-X2571LN PTZ.
Diagnose Network Configuration Issues
Verify VLAN Assignment
i-Pro cameras require VLAN tagging if deployed on a dedicated security network. In i-PRO Configuration Tool, navigate to Network > VLAN Settings and confirm the VLAN ID matches the switch port configuration. For models like the WV-S8574L Multi-Sensor, ensure QoS prioritization is enabled for video streams to prevent packet loss.
Validate PoE Budget
Use the PoE Budget Monitor in i-PRO Configuration Tool to check if the switch port is overloaded. For the WV-X2571LN PTZ, confirm the port supports PoE++ (802.3bt). If the PoE budget is exhausted, reconfigure the switch to allocate Class 4 power to the camera. Avoid using PoE++ on switches that only support 802.3af.
Check DHCP Lease and Multicast Settings
In the DHCP Server on your network, verify the camera has a valid lease and is not experiencing IP conflict. For i-Pro cameras using multicast streams, ensure IGMP Snooping is enabled on the switch to prevent multicast traffic flooding. Disable IGMP Snooping if the camera is on a dedicated VLAN.
Resolve VMS Integration Failures
Re-Register the Camera in VMS
If the camera is visible in the VMS but shows no video, re-register it via the Camera Registration section in your VMS (e.g. Wisenet WAVE or Avigilon Control Center). For i-Pro S-Series models with dual sensors, ensure both sensors are enabled in the Sensor Configuration menu. A missing sensor can cause partial or complete video loss.
Verify Stream Profile Compatibility
In i-PRO Configuration Tool, check the stream profile (e.g. Main Stream for 1080p) and ensure it matches the VMS's requirements. For models like the WV-S2536L Dome, use iA mode for automatic exposure adjustment unless manual settings are required for challenging lighting.
Check Licensing and Database Health
In your VMS, confirm there are no licensing limitations preventing the camera from streaming. For Wisenet WAVE, use the Database Consistency Checker to identify corruption in the VMS database. A corrupted entry can cause the camera to appear online but unresponsive.

Factory Reset Model-Specific Instructions
For the WV-S2536L Dome, press and hold the INITIAL SET button for 15 seconds until the status indicator flashes. For the WV-X2571LN PTZ, access the maintenance panel and press the INITIAL SET button for 15 seconds. For the WV-S8574L Multi-Sensor, press the INITIAL SET button on the rear of the camera body for 15 seconds until the status LED changes.
